Paunra Chak is a Rural village located in Dharhara, Munger, Bihar.

The total population of Paunra Chak is 409.

Paunra Chak village comprises 76 households.

The literacy rate in Paunra Chak is 76%. Among the literate population of 253, there are 137 literate males and 116 literate females.

In Paunra Chak, there are 205 males and 204 females, with a sex ratio of 995 females per 1000 males.

There are 76 children (18.6% of population), comprising 40 boys and 36 girls.

The total number of workers in Paunra Chak is 103, with 63 main workers and 40 marginal workers.

Paunra Chak is located in Bihar state, Munger district, and falls under Dharhara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 242772 and LGD code is 242772.
